Existing law requires the summary of a bill or joint resolution introduced in the Legislature to include certain statements relating to the fiscal effect on the State and local government. (NRS 218D.415) Section 1 of this bill amends the summary of a bill or joint resolution relating to the fiscal effect on the State from “Effect on the State: Yes” to “Effect on the State: May have Fiscal Impact.” Section 1 further requires the summary of a bill or resolution to include certain statements relating to the fiscal effect of the bill or joint resolution on the State Highway Fund. Existing law provides that, if a bill or joint resolution is submitted to a local government for a fiscal note and the local government determines the bill or joint resolution reduces the revenues or increases the expenditures of the local government, the local government is required to prepare a fiscal note and return it to the Fiscal Analysis Division of the Legislative Counsel Bureau within 8 working days. (NRS 218D.475) Section 1.5 of this bill authorizes the Fiscal Analysis Division to extend the period of time to return the fiscal note by not more than 7 additional days if the matter requires extended research.
